Galactus in Marvel Comics is a powerful and destructive cosmic entity that lives by consuming planets. He is popularly known as the "Devourer of Worlds", the energy he consumes makes him omnipotent.
Galactus, the Devourer of Worlds, is one of the greatest antagonists in Marvel Comics history. We say antagonist and not villain, because Galactus is a character whose motivations hold no real malice.
